Motion tools
Normal playback can carry a contact pose or spacing change past too quickly to inspect.
Slow the source or move one frame at a time.
Slow or accelerate playback, then move forward or backward one frame at a time when a pose, contact point, or transition passes too quickly to read.
See a run of GIF frames together while you inspect one frame.
Use onion skinning to fade surrounding frames over the current image and reveal changes in timing, spacing, and direction.
